I finished processing this one today. I had used an 85B filter on front of the lens, then custom white balanced using an ExpoDisc. In SPP I turned sharpening all the way down, and had Detail set to one dot below Crispy, and had all noise suppression turned to minimum. In photoshop elements I downsized using bilinear, with careful sharpening and not too much, and played with the color balance some more. Then I bumped the contrast just a little. I was trying for better browns and tans with darker skies. Maybe almost... I remember the yellows being more intense that day but I don't see it here.
